Mail sent without stamp; what happens?

Hey guys, i did something really stupid while i was in a rush to do a bunch of chores today. I mailed out an important mail without a STAMP! it has all the neccesary info , return address, but i just forgot to put the stamp on it. What will happen to this mail ? What can i do to move this along, cause this an important mail!

please help

(it was mailed @ a mailbox on no.3 and williams): cry:

some times they dont return it, cause a lot of "smart" people before put in the address were they want in the return address part, and a fake and non-valet address on the main address part. so when the post office "returns" the mail it actually makes it to the right destination

so they don't do that anymore
for letters it's some bin
for parcel's they hold it and sends a notice to the return address
